Apartment and co-op leak diagnosis is structured for water crossing unit boundaries, shared plumbing, restricted access, management coordination, and the need for factual findings. The goal is to determine what plumbing condition is supported by testing without turning a service visit into a legal or engineering opinion.
The damaged apartment may not contain the source. A useful investigation identifies which units, fixtures, valves, and common systems need to be available before testing begins.

One occupant connects the stain to shower use while another reports no leak. A controlled timeline and repeatable test are more reliable than recollection alone.
Moisture follows a riser, pipe chase, common wall, or branch serving multiple fixtures. Building staff may need to identify valves and plumbing history.
The board, manager, owner, or insurer needs a factual account of access, observed conditions, tests performed, and any confirmed plumbing failure.
Sealant, fixture work, patches, or finish restoration were completed without reproducing the source. The investigation needs to restart from the event pattern rather than repeat assumptions.
The suspected source unit, roof area, service room, or shutoff is unavailable. The diagnostic result must distinguish what was tested from what could not be evaluated.
Private fixtures, apartment branches, common risers, drainage stacks, wet-room assemblies, and exterior systems can overlap within the same floor and ceiling construction.
A toilet, shower, tub, sink, appliance, valve, supply, or drain may release water beneath finished surfaces before the upper apartment shows obvious damage.
A shared vertical or horizontal line can leak inside a chase serving several units. Isolation and authorization differ from a tenant-controlled fixture connection.
Intermittent leakage may follow discharge from one or more units. Testing must consider stack flow and accessible branch connections rather than only one fixture.
Water can pass through an enclosure, curb, penetration, membrane, or renovated floor even when the supply and drain piping test normally.
Upper-floor and perimeter symptoms may come from the exterior building envelope. Weather correlation should remain part of the record.
The sequence changes with the line, fixture, property, and access, but the source-control logic stays disciplined.
Identify the damaged space, suspected source spaces, property representative, access authority, and any occupants who need to operate fixtures or observe the result.
Compare when the symptom appears with fixture use, occupancy, weather, maintenance, and previous repairs. Conflicting accounts are recorded rather than silently resolved.
Map the visible damage below against fixtures, chases, walls, floors, and accessible plumbing above or adjacent. Review existing openings and valve locations.
Operate one likely source at a time while monitoring the receiving area. Building staff may assist with access and shared-system identification.
State what was accessible, what was observed, which conditions were tested, what reproduced the symptom, what plumbing failure was confirmed, and what remains unresolved.
The plumbing technician’s role is to investigate physical conditions. That includes documenting visible moisture, identifying accessible plumbing, operating fixtures under controlled conditions, observing changes, and confirming a failed component when possible. The report or summary should not jump from those facts to legal responsibility, negligence, ownership allocation, or insurance coverage.
Access is part of the diagnostic system. If only the damaged apartment is available, the technician may identify likely routes and rule out accessible local sources, but cannot honestly certify conditions inside the unit above. If a riser valve or service space remains locked, shared piping may also remain untested. Limitations belong in the finding so the next party understands what the visit established.
When the source is confirmed, the repair scope depends on whether the failed component is privately controlled, part of a common system, or within an assembly requiring another trade. The board or manager may need to authorize a shutdown, approve access through common property, notify occupants, or select a building contractor. Diagnosis should make that decision easier without pretending to make it for them.
The same visible symptom can lead to different work. These are the decisions that prevent a one-size-fits-all recommendation.
The damaged unit, likely source unit, and sometimes an adjacent apartment or service space may all be necessary for a controlled test.
Fixture supplies and seals differ from risers, stacks, and common branches in authority, shutdown impact, and repair responsibility.
A reproduced plumbing failure supports a defined result. Incomplete access or an intermittent dry condition may support only an interim finding and next-test plan.
Co-ops, condos, rentals, and managed multifamily properties use different access, approval, maintenance, and documentation processes even when the physical plumbing is similar.
Valve locations, riser history, prior repairs, renovation patterns, and access procedures may not appear in drawings. Building staff can supply critical context.
Useful findings identify conditions and tests. Vague statements such as “leak from above” are weaker than a confirmed fixture component, observed response, and stated limitation.
Coordinating relevant units for the same window reduces inconclusive visits and allows the source action and receiving-area response to be observed in real time.

A diagnosis is also limited by access and conditions at the time of testing. An intermittent leak may not reproduce during one visit. A locked apartment may contain the relevant source. A weather-dependent symptom may require later observation. Those limitations are valid findings and should be preserved rather than replaced with unsupported certainty.
